Highlights
- Pro
-
Adder-Subtractor-Circuits Public
Parametrized Verilog implementation of different architectures of adder / subtractor circuits.
-
YouTube-Downloader Public
A python application used for downloading YouTube playlists and videos.
-
Glassifier Public
Gender classifier based on handwriting using Machine Learning techniques
-
-
Human-Body-Level-Classifier Public
Human body level classifier using machine learning algorithms.
-
DNA-Sequence-Classifier Public
DNA sequence classifier using deep learning.
-
Flood-Detector Public
Flood detector based on satellite images using Machine Learning & Deep Learning.
-
PrUcess Public
PrUcess is a low-power multi-clock configurable digital processing system that executes commands (unsigned arithmetic operations, logical operations, register file read & write operations) which ar…
-
Solution to the Machine Intelligence course assignments.
-
Solution to the Advanced Microprocessors course midterm (this solution earned the full grade "20/20").
-
SymphonyOS Public
OS simulation for the scheduler and memory management modules.
C GNU General Public License v3.0 UpdatedApr 21, 2023 -
Restaurant-Simulation Public
A simulation of the operation of a real restaurant using data structures implemented in C++.
-
Signal-Processing-Labs Public
Solution to the labs, assignments, and course projects for the following university courses: Signals & Systems, Communication Engineering, and Digital Communication using MATLAB and Python.
Jupyter Notebook UpdatedApr 21, 2023 -
Topology-API Public
An API library which reads and writes topologies to and from disk, stores multiple topologies in memory, and executes various operations on topologies.
C++ UpdatedApr 18, 2023 -
Home-Automation-System Public
System Design, RTL implementation using VHDL, logic synthesis using Oasys tool, and physical design (floor planning, power planning, placement, and routing) using Nitro SoC tool of a home automatio…
-
Machine-Learning-Labs Public
Solution to the labs of the Pattern Recognition and Neural Networks course.
-
OS-Labs Public
Solution to the OS course labs. It includes bash scripting and C programming (Forking - Signals - IPC - Semaphores).
-
Crazy-Taxi Public
A mimic to crazy taxi game implemented in C++ using OpenGL API
-
-
-
XenoM-Processor Public
Design & implementation of a five-stage pipelined RISC processor.
-
Jungle-Run-Game Public
Forked from osamamagdy/Jungle-Run-GameA Ladder & Snake game that is coded in C++ depending on OOP paradigm, it is enhanced with Monopoly game features like cards for punishing and rewarding or buy cells to get money when other players …
C UpdatedFeb 27, 2022 -
2-Player-Soccer-Game Public
A two-player game using serial port communication between two computers implemented using x86 assembly.
Assembly UpdatedFeb 19, 2022 -
ONpharma Public
Online health care website that connects patients, doctors, and pharmacists on one platform.
JavaScript UpdatedFeb 19, 2022 -
Search-Engine Public
A web-based search engine that supports text-based search.
Java UpdatedFeb 19, 2022 -
CMPLR-Cross-Platform Public
A complete cross-platform mimic of Tumblr social media app.
JavaScript UpdatedFeb 19, 2022